Vontier (VNT) has scheduled a conference call and webcast for August 6, 2026, to review its second quarter 2026 financial results, giving investors fresh information to reassess the stock’s recent performance.

Vontier’s recent momentum has picked up into the upcoming results, with a 1-day share price return of 3.10% and a 7-day share price return of 5.81%. However, the 90-day share price return declined 17.96% and the 1-year total shareholder return declined 20.19%, suggesting short-term interest against a weaker longer-term backdrop.

Most Popular Narrative: 18.2% Undervalued

According to the most followed narrative on Vontier, a fair value of $37.42 sits above the recent $30.60 close, framing the stock as materially discounted before the upcoming earnings call.

Vontier has inherited a proven business system of disciplined capital allocation and continuous improvement from its former parent companies, Danaher and Fortive. u The spinoff from Fortive will allow Vontier to redeploy capital to its business, as its former parent invested less than 5% of its total M&A capital in Vontier.

Want to unpack why this narrative points to a higher price for Vontier? According to julio, the story leans heavily on recurring revenue, disciplined capital use, and a future profit multiple that assumes meaningful earnings expansion without stretching into hype territory.

Result: Fair Value of $37.42 (UNDERVALUED)

However, Vontier’s core revenue growth concerns and the threat that electric vehicles pose to its retail fueling exposure could both weaken confidence in this undervaluation story.
